Fishwhisperer,
The camping is also free if u can believe that:) Pretty rare anything is free these days. BONUS! As far as directions go, just keep your eyes open on the highway, there are small signs, and if in doubt just talk to the locals around Grassy lake or any of the small towns along the way, they will point you in the right direction:)
One more thing, most the lil hick town stores are closed on Sundays so if your going on a weekend make sure to stock up on bait before you get out there or you may have to drive a ways to get more if ya run out. Learned this one the hard way.

There are lots of free camping spots at the forks, was in there sat. Water has finally receded. Depends on your camper if your pulling it in or on the back of your truck. First part is a little rough if you dont mind. As for firewood theres more than anyone needs to burn, just go get it. Oh and please be carefull theres lots of cotton which is like gas. Try not to use pickeral rigs for sturgeon as you have read, but saying that i use them for walleye using minnows, leeches, and worms, and consistantly catch both. Only thing i find is using worms i catch way to many suckers ,but to each his own. OH YEAH, CAUGHT MY BIGGEST STURGEON IN MY LIFE 55" last wed. on 2" minnows. GOOD LUCK!

Yes there are lots of spots for camping on the island.But there are a limited amount of fishing spots on the island.Once the 12 camping spots on the beach are full theres not much room left to fish.There might be room for 15 fishing rods along the beach.And thats the only spot to fish on the island.
